Image to Base64 | Image to Base64 in Python | PNG to Base64 | JPG to Base64

Base64 ist ein beliebtes Kodierungsschema, das Binärdaten in eine Zeichenfolge alphanumerischer Zeichen umwandelt. Es ist eine perfekte Lösung für den Umgang mit Bildern und bietet ein universelles Format für den Datenaustausch, da es Bilddaten als Zeichenfolge darstellen kann. Die Arbeit mit Bilddaten als Zeichenfolge erleichtert verschiedene Manipulations- und Verarbeitungsaufgaben, wie z.B. das Ändern der Größe, Zuschneiden und Anwenden von Filtern. Wir können Base64-codierte Bilder direkt in HTML-Code einbetten, was die Ladegeschwindigkeit der Seite verbessert. Außerdem können wir Base64-codierte Bilder direkt in Datenbanken speichern. In diesem Blogbeitrag erfahren wir, wie man ein Bild in Python in Base64 umwandelt.

Dieser Artikel behandelt die folgenden Themen:

  1. Python Image to Base64 Converter API
  2. Bild in Base64 umwandeln
  3. Ein PNG-Bild in Base64 umwandeln
  4. Das Bild online in Base64 umwandeln
  5. Kostenlose Ressourcen

Python Image to Base64 Converter API

Um JPG- oder PNG-Bilder in Base64 umzuwandeln, verwenden wir Aspose.SVG für Python. Die Aspose.SVG für Python-Bibliothek vereinfacht die Arbeit mit Scalable Vector Graphics (SVG) in Python. Eine ihrer Hauptfunktionen ist die mühelose Umwandlung von Bildern in das Base64-Format.

Bitte laden Sie das Paket herunter oder installieren Sie die API von PyPI mit dem folgenden pip-Befehl in der Konsole:

pip install aspose-svg-net 

JPG-Bild in Base64 in Python umwandeln

Schritt-für-Schritt-Anleitung zur Umwandlung von Bildern in Base64 in Python:

  1. Laden Sie zunächst das Eingangs-JPG-Bild, das Sie umwandeln möchten.
  2. Initialisieren Sie eine Instanz der SVGDocument-Klasse, um Ihre SVG-Datei darzustellen.
  3. Erstellen Sie ein Bildelement mit der Methode create_element_ns().
  4. Verwenden Sie die entsprechende Methode, um die Bilddaten in das Base64-Format umzuwandeln.
  5. Setzen Sie den Base64-String-Wert mit der set_attribute()-Methode auf das href-Attribut.
  6. Fügen Sie das Bildelement in das SVG-Dokument ein.
  7. Rufen Sie abschließend die save()-Methode auf, um das SVG-Dokument zu speichern, das nun das Base64-codierte Bild enthält.

Der folgende Code zeigt wie man ein JPG-Bild in Python in Base64 umwandelt.

JPG- oder PNG-Bild in Python in Base64 umwandeln

JPG-Bild in Base64 in Python umwandeln

PNG zu Base64 in Python

Der Prozess der Umwandlung von PNG-Bildern in Base64 ist ähnlich wie bei der Umwandlung von JPG-Bildern. Folgen Sie einfach den gleichen Schritten wie oben beschrieben, ersetzen Sie jedoch das Eingangs-JPG-Bild durch ein PNG-Bild.

Kostenlose Lizenz erhalten

Möchten Sie Aspose.SVG ohne Einschränkungen ausprobieren? Holen Sie sich eine kostenlose temporäre Lizenz und entdecken Sie noch heute die leistungsstarken Funktionen!

Bild in Base64 umwandeln: Online

Zusätzlich können Sie Bilder auch online in Base64 umwandeln, ohne Software zu installieren. Verwenden Sie dieses kostenlose Bild-zu-Base64-Konverter-Online-Tool. Es funktioniert auf jedem Gerät und Browser und erfordert keine Downloads oder Abonnements.

Bild in Base64-String: Kostenlose Ressourcen

Neben der Umwandlung von Bildern in Base64 bietet Aspose.SVG viele weitere Funktionen. Schauen Sie sich diese Ressourcen an, um mehr zu erfahren:

Fazit

In diesem Artikel haben wir gelernt, wie man JPG- oder PNG-Bilder mit Python in Base64-Strings umwandelt. Die Base64-Codierung ist eine wertvolle Technik für die Arbeit mit Bildern. Sie ermöglicht es, Bilder direkt in HTML einzubetten, sicher über Netzwerke zu übertragen, in Datenbanken zu speichern und verschiedene Bildbearbeitungen durchzuführen.

Aspose.SVG für Python bietet eine leistungsstarke und benutzerfreundliche Möglichkeit, Bilder in Base64 umzuwandeln. Mit seiner benutzerfreundlichen API und den umfangreichen Funktionen vereinfacht es den Prozess und ermöglicht es Ihnen, die Bildbearbeitung nahtlos in Ihre Python-Projekte zu integrieren.

Bei Unklarheiten kontaktieren Sie uns bitte in unserem kostenlosen Support-Forum.

Siehe auch